Alternatives to Google Bug Hunters include:
1. Microsoft Security Response Center
2. Apple Security Bounty
3. Facebook Bug Bounty
4. GitHub Security Bug Bounty
5. Mozilla Security Bug Bounty
6. PayPal Bug Bounty Program
7. Samsung Mobile Security Rewards Program
8. Uber Bug Bounty Program
These are just a few examples of bug bounty programs offered by various companies. Each program may have its own rules, rewards, and scope, so it’s important to carefully review the details before participating.
